    Balaenoptera physalus

This is the second largest mammal alive just after the Blue whale. 

Fin whales can reach up to 20 meters long ! 

Although it is possible to observe them all year round, we tend to see them more often during the summer months. 

The dorsal colour varies from silvery-grey to dark blue. 

Alone, more often than not, they can navigate in groups of up to 5 animals. 

Crustaceans, small fish and cephalopods are their feeding choices. 

They are short divers: 10 to 20 minutes to only 200 meters deep, on average.
